Worthy Cause Visit: John Fawcett Foundation Project Visit

If you’re registered, you’ll be visiting a truly amazing Village Eye-Check Day to see how lives are transformed when the villagers receive free eye-checks, glasses and cataract operations through this fantastic Worthy Cause project in Bali.

About The Grand Hyatt

Designed to resemble a traditional Balinese water palace, the Grand Hyatt in Nusa Dua spans 41 acres of lush tropical gardens and features 636 rooms and suites distributed across four villages. Each accommodation offers a private balcony or patio with views of the gardens or the Indian Ocean.

Guests can enjoy five swimming pools, including a river pool with water slides and a secluded Balinese feature pool. The resort also offers a variety of dining options and for relaxation, the Kriya Spa provides traditional Balinese treatments in luxurious spa villas.
